Staff Frontend Engineer

ClickUp ClickUp · Enterprise · United States · Engineering

Staff Frontend Engineer to lead the design and development of major frontend systems and product initiatives at ClickUp, a company that offers a converged AI workspace unifying tasks, docs, chat, calendar, and enterprise search. The role involves working across teams to solve complex technical challenges, improve engineering velocity, and shape frontend architecture, with a focus on Angular 2+ and React.

What you'd actually do

  1. Lead development of complex product features and frontend systems in Angular 2+ and React.
  2. Partner with backend, integrations, product, design, and QA to deliver high-quality user experiences at speed
  3. Architect scalable, reusable frontend patterns that improve product quality and developer velocity
  4. Identify and address performance bottlenecks, UI architecture issues, and scalability risks
  5. Drive engineering best practices across testing, observability, code quality, and maintainability

Skills

Required

  • 7+ years of frontend engineering experience
  • Angular 2+
  • React
  • TypeScript
  • RxJS
  • NgRx
  • modern frontend architecture patterns
  • reusable component systems
  • scalable frontend application structures
  • performance optimization
  • debugging
  • large-scale web applications
  • product sense
  • cross-functional collaboration
  • leading major technical initiatives
  • mentorship
  • communication skills
  • execution skills
  • unit testing
  • integration testing
  • end to end testing
  • jest
  • vilest
  • playwright

Nice to have

  • AI in ways that shape not only our product, but the future of work itself

What the JD emphasized

  • Angular 2+ and React
  • TypeScript, RxJS, NgRx
  • performance optimization
  • leading major technical initiatives